DAMASCUS, Ohio - Firefighters were on the scene of a blaze and smoke in Damascus. According to a dispatcher with the Damascus Fire Department, the call came in around 4:45 p.m. for a fire at Martig Farms, located at 10210 State Route 534 near Damascus. The source of the blaze was a large pile of tires.

Israel Bombs Damascus, Warns Syria of ‘Painful Blows’ as Footage Shows Hit on Defense Ministry
The Israel Defense Forces (IDF) said the Damascus headquarters served as a command center for deploying regime forces to Suwayda, a southern Syrian region gripped by days of deadly clashes between government troops, Druze militias, and Bedouin groups.

Israel carried out heavy airstrikes in the heart of Damascus on Wednesday, hitting Syrian Defense Ministry headquarters and an area near the presidential palace.
The Israeli military launched airstrikes in the heart of Damascus on Wednesday, hitting the Syrian Defense Ministry headquarters.
The attack follows a wave of Israeli strikes on Syrian government forces during two days of sectarian clashes between local Druze and Bedouin populations.
THE HAGUE (Reuters) -Israeli airstrikes on Damascus are hampering Syria's efforts to find and destroy chemical weapons stockpiled during the rule of toppled ruler Bashar al-Assad, a government adviser said on Thursday.
